Types of Mole Removal Treatments and their Costs in India

The type of mole removal treatment that you choose also determines the cost of mole removal in India. The most common types of mole removal treatments are excision and surgery. 

  • Excision:

Excision is the most cost-effective form of treatment. This method is used to remove small moles that are easily accessible.

It is also used when the mole is dark in color and has a rounded shape.

The cost of excision is between INR 4,000 and INR 10,000.

  • Surgery:

Surgery is the most expensive form of treatment. This method is used to remove large moles that are not easily accessible. 

Surgery is also used when the mole is light in color and has an irregular shape.

Mole removal surgery costs in India between INR 10,000 and INR 30,000.

  • Laser Treatment:

A laser beam is projected at the mole. The laser destroys skin cells to eliminate the moles. It is the most precise and quickest mole removal method.

Laser treatment for mole removal cost in India is estimated at Rs. 20,000 to rs. 40,000.

Factors Affecting the Cost of Mole Removal

The cost of mole removal in India is mainly dependent on the following factors: 

  • Number of Moles that are Removed:

The more moles you have, the more expensive the procedure will be. 

  • Type of Mole Removal Treatment: 

The type of mole removal treatment that you choose affects the final cost. Surgery is the most expensive treatment, while excision is the cheapest. - 

  • Location of the Moles:

The location of the moles also determines the price of mole removal.  If the moles are in areas like the face, the removal cost will be more than if the moles were in other body parts.

How to get rid of fibrosis after lipo?

Female | 51

The treatment after liposuction of fibrosis is a blend procedure. Massaging the affected areas regularly will break down scar tissue and enhance skin elasticity. In some instances, specialized treatments like lymphatic drainage massage or radiofrequency therapy can also be suggested to treat fibrosis. With proper hydration, balanced diet and regular exercise a healthy lifestyle can sustain the overall healing process. There must be strict adherence to the post-operative care instructions given by your surgeon and make sure that you attend all follow up visits for a thorough evaluation of how well you are recovering. If concerns continue, seek advice from your surgeon regarding the management of fibrosis subsequent to liposuction.

I have uneven breasts since puberty one is larger than the other. Is this normal or does it need correction?

Female | 26

Mild asymmetry between breasts is common and normal. However, if the difference is significant or causing discomfort or self-consciousness, surgical options like breast reshaping or fat grafting can be considered. It’s not a medical problem unless accompanied by a lump or discharge.
